Each line contains a link to the page for that movie. (There were 29 links in what you quoted.) They only really did one page for each movie, although they came up with an archive page with 50 page titles each time. As I understand it, the idea was that when the comic got to page 50, they showed an alternate universe in which the D&D players were doing a campaign based on Harry Potter. They created a website with the page, and included an archive, cast, and FAQ pages. Then when they got up to page 100, they duplicated what they had done for Harry Potter, but with The Sound of Music and so on.
